Pendleton ranks #19 of 87 Indiana cities tracked here by median home value, and sits 26.8% above the state's city median of $270,079. It sits in Madison County, where the county-wide median is $193,723.
Pendleton police recorded a violent crime rate of 34 per 100,000 residents in 2024 — lower than most cities that report to the FBI. Property crime runs at 51 per 100,000.
Reported by the city's own police department to the FBI's Uniform Crime Reporting Program (what this covers).
